Monteith Brown Planning Consultants in partnership with City of Sarnia has completed a Draft Indoor Multi-Use Recreation Facility Feasibility Study and is hosting a virtual presentation/webinar to collect feedback from Sarnia residents and stakeholders. The Study outlines the key components of what it will take and what to consider with respect to a new indoor multi-use recreation facility for the City of Sarnia. Key components include a review and analysis of other similar facilities for context and scope, initial public feedback and input, trends and demographic review, recreational needs assessments, operating and capital cost considerations, operating model considerations, location criteria, and the associated ranking of potential locations.

All residents and community organizations were invited to participate in this study through the virtual presentation held on January 31, 2022.
